Maximize Your Impact at Pink26 2026
Pink26 2026, taking place February 16 at the Bellagio Hotel & Casino in Las Vegas, is a long-standing industry event focused on IT service management, enterprise leadership, and organizational change. Known for bringing together decision-makers in IT, HR, change management, and digital transformation, Pink26 offers an opportunity to engage with leaders shaping business-critical strategies for the year ahead.
This event attracts executives responsible for setting budgets, approving technology upgrades, and implementing process frameworks such as ITIL and Agile. Where Is Pink26 2026?
The event will be held at the Bellagio Hotel & Casino in Las Vegas, Nevada, United States.
When Is Pink26 2026?
Pink26 2026 is scheduled for February 16, 2026.
What Type of Event Is Pink26 2026?
Pink26 is a cross-industry management conference focused on service management frameworks, leadership alignment, and change integration across enterprise IT and business operations. The event includes keynotes, certification courses, thought leadership panels, and peer networking across sectors such as healthcare, government, education, and finance.
How Many People Attend Pink26 2026?
Pink26 typically draws over 1,000 professionals from across North America and beyond, primarily in senior IT, business operations, and organizational development roles. The audience includes vice presidents, directors, strategy leads, and team leaders managing large-scale service and operational frameworks.
